Idaho Supreme Court voids Republican Legislature’s newest anti-initiative law

Excerpt: Senate Bill 1110 does not comport with the Gem State's plan of government because it infringes upon the fundamental rights of direct democracy guaranteed to Idahoans by Article III, Section I of the state's constitution.

Idaho overwhelmingly votes to expand Medicaid; Proposition #2 Yes vote tops 60%!

Excerpt: Voters in Idaho are giving a big thumbs up to a ballot measure to expand Medicaid to cover low income adults and people without children.
